1.Spurious
Meaning: not being what it purports to be; false or fake.
Synonym: specious, false, fictitious, counterfeit, fraudulent
Antonym: authentic, genuine, real

2.Badinage
Meaning: humorous or witty conversation
Synonym: repartee
Sentence: “he developed a nice line in badinage with the Labour leader”

3.Pugnacious
Meaning: eager or quick to argue, quarrel, or fight.
Synonym: combative, aggressive, antagonistic,
Antonym: peaceable, friendly
Sentence: “the increasingly pugnacious demeanour of right-wing politicians”

4.Besotted
Meaning: Very Drunk
Synonym: Buzzed, drunk
Antonym: Sober, straight
Sentence : I had travelling money and got besotted in the bar downstairs

5.Pejorative
Meaning : expressing contempt or disapproval.
Synonym : disparaging, derogatory, denigratory, deprecatory,
Antonym : complimentary, approbatory
Sentence:”permissiveness is used almost universally as a pejorative term”
